Congratulations to Paul Thorpe and John Drain who successfully attempted the climb to the summit of Kilimanjaro, the highest free standing mountain in the world at 5,895m.

They put in the training hours and completed the challenge in February 2011.    

This is what Paul had to say about his experience:

"I am pleased to say that I managed to make it to the top. As expected I had to endure all those problems, diarrhoea, dehydration and lack of sleep (mainly down to Johns snoring) and of course, exhaustion. So in the main the whole experience was good value for money. I have been back now for a couple of weeks and just about recovered, my bed never felt so good!"

We know they endured a tough and arduous challenge, so from everyone at CHICKS, we would like to say a special 'thank you' to Paul and John for their incredible efforts.

In addition, they have collectively raised a staggering £15,990! Well done guys and CONGRATULATIONS!
